Output 21a813fca08ac136098bfa8e2ba47f237af8eba785aa62677f6fa83adc9db7d4:4

value
209135551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 634db57bc8d3b67163baf80451a1cae5c1f3058f OP_EQUAL
address
MGxEDjQ6iPvPTvo8ycbZHmUGNvYH52ZLAu
transaction
21a813fca08ac136098bfa8e2ba47f237af8eba785aa62677f6fa83adc9db7d4
spent
true